Transfer Agreements with 4-year institutions

Fulton-Montgomery Community College has entered into transfer agreements with several public and private universities. A transfer agreement is a detailed sequence of course work that has been pre-approved by the transfer institution. This allows students to transfer all their FMCC credit and achieve junior standing at the institution they are attending.

New agreements are added each semester. We are committed to offering our students quality transfer agreement opportunities so they may continue their education beyond there associates degree at FMCC.

University at Buffalo
A.A.S. in Criminal Justice to a B.A. Sociology: Concentration in Law and Criminology
A.S. in Spatial Information Technology into a B.A. Geography
**Dual Admissions Program


Students selected for matriculation in this program will, upon completion of a prescribed sequence of courses leading to an associate degree from Fulton-Montgomery Community College, continue their studies at University at Buffalo (UB) with assurance that they may complete all requirements for the corresponding baccalaureate degree upon completion of four semesters of full time course work.  Dual admission students are not required to file an application for admission to UB but instead submit a one page Intent to Enroll form in the beginning of their intended transfer term.  In addition, no tuition deposit will be required of students who transfer through this program.

Note: Any student who successfully completes FMCC’s A.S. degree in Engineering Science will receive two full years of transfer credit upon acceptance at engineering colleges who are members of the Association of Engineering Colleges of New York State.
